When choosing a chapel there are so many things to pay attention to. First of all, its looks. It needs to look good, to be surrounded by parks and benches. You also need to pay attention to the number of seats available. So a too big chapel for a small wedding might give the impression that there are guests missing or something like that. A too small chapel would look very crowded and unwelcoming. Another detail is the light. I believe a natural light coming from outside through big windows is wonderful. And then, as in the comment above, it’s the minister who officiates the wedding that needs to make you feel you trust him.
